Just remembered, from AlexK

shimmy, I could be wrong but I think the electric fan is also installed on the non-AC cars.

The fan is used to provide additional cooling to the engine. It's not used just for the AC.

Here are the maps that show how the fan is operated.

Temperature (°C)|Operation/speed (%)
|49°C|0%
|50°C|30%
|70°C|40%
|80°C|65%
|85°C|83%
|90°C|100%

The second map, that changes the voltage supply depending on the speed.
Above 140km/h it's deactivated.

speed (km/h)|Voltage (index)
|0 km/h|1
|50 km/h|1
|100 km/h|1
|120 km/h|0.5
|140 km/h|0
|200 km/h|0
